Lutz leaves Kyosho For Tamiya!
report from Neo-Buggy..
In a shock move, team manager and top Kyosho driver Ryan Lutz will leave his post at Kyosho America and move to 1/8 offroad newcomers Tamiya. Could this move signal Tamiya's intent to establish themselves in the hotly contested buggy market ? Lutz has been instrumental in setting up Kyosho America's racing presence, and with a big name driver expected to be announced quite soon, is Lutz making way?
More news soon.
